Artwork Description

Angélica Arbulú’s work examines adolescence as a liminal and fleeting stage of life. Her intimate portraits capture this transformative period, where the innocence of childhood gives way to the uncertainties and promises of adulthood. Through her exploration of everyday rituals, Arbulú reveals beauty in the seemingly mundane and instills a sense of calm and courage in the face of inevitable change. Arbulú’s practice draws from her extensive experience in psychology, humanitarian work, and global perspectives. Her photography has been exhibited at notable venues, including the ICP NY and PhotoEspaña. Recognized for her poignant storytelling, she has received honors such as the PRIX3 Paris award and the Black & White Spider Awards, solidifying her reputation in the field.
